CrawlJobs Logo

Filters

Location
Salary
Clear all filters

Principal Engineer Jobs

1590 Job Offers

Principal Software Engineer
Save Icon
Lead the design of secure, large-scale cloud infrastructure at Microsoft Security in Bangalore. This principal engineering role requires 13+ years of experience, deep expertise in distributed systems (C++, C#, Python), and a focus on data governance. You will architect critical platforms, set tec...
Location Icon
Location
India , Bangalore
Salary Icon
Salary
Not provided
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Principal Software Engineer - Azure Key Vault
Save Icon
Lead the development of critical security infrastructure as a Principal Software Engineer for Azure Key Vault in Redmond. This role requires 8+ years of experience in C, C++, C#, or Python and expertise in distributed cloud services. You will design resilient systems to protect digital assets in ...
Location Icon
Location
United States , Redmond
Salary Icon
Salary
163000.00 - 296400.00 USD / Year
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Principal Software Engineer
Save Icon
Join Microsoft's global Industry Solutions Engineering team as a Principal Software Engineer. Leverage your 8+ years of coding expertise in C#, Java, Python, or similar to solve complex customer challenges with cloud-based solutions. This role involves collaborative innovation, travel up to 25%, ...
Location Icon
Location
United States , Multiple Locations
Salary Icon
Salary
163000.00 - 296400.00 USD / Year
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Principal Engineer - Physical Security Innovation
Save Icon
Lead physical security innovation for Microsoft's global cloud infrastructure in Dublin. Design and implement cutting-edge security systems across a vast network of datacenters. Requires expertise in physical security engineering, threat modeling, and a relevant technical degree. Play a key role ...
Location Icon
Location
Ireland , Dublin
Salary Icon
Salary
Not provided
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Principal Software Engineer, CoreAI
Save Icon
Lead the development of Azure's foundational GPU infrastructure for large-scale AI training and inference. Design and build high-performance, reliable systems at the intersection of virtualization, containers, and cloud platforms. This senior role in Redmond requires deep expertise in systems sof...
Location Icon
Location
United States , Redmond
Salary Icon
Salary
139900.00 - 274800.00 USD / Year
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Principal Open Source AI/ML Solutions Engineer
Save Icon
Lead the architecture and development of cutting-edge GPU software for next-gen AI/ML accelerators in Bangalore. This senior role demands expert C++/Python skills, deep AI/ML framework knowledge, and open-source collaboration. Drive innovation in high-performance computing within the ROCm ecosystem.
Location Icon
Location
India , Bangalore
Salary Icon
Salary
Not provided
amd.com Logo
AMD
Expiration Date
Until further notice
Principal AI Safety Engineer for Autonomous Vehicles Technical Lead
Save Icon
Lead the AI safety strategy for autonomous vehicles at GM. This technical leadership role requires 10+ years in AI/ML and 5+ in AVs, with deep expertise in model validation and safety-critical standards. You will define safety engineering guidance, influence industry standards, and ensure operati...
Location Icon
Location
United States
Salary Icon
Salary
250600.00 - 384600.00 USD / Year
gm.com Logo
General Motors
Expiration Date
Until further notice
Principal ML Engineer - Large Scale Training Performance Optimization
Save Icon
Join our Models and Applications team as a Principal ML Engineer. Optimize large-scale distributed training of generative AI models on AMD GPUs using PyTorch/JAX. Drive performance improvements in the end-to-end pipeline and contribute to open source. This role is based in San Jose or Bellevue, USA.
Location Icon
Location
United States , San Jose; Bellevue
Salary Icon
Salary
226400.00 - 339600.00 USD / Year
amd.com Logo
AMD
Expiration Date
Until further notice
Principal ASIC Design Verification Engineer
Save Icon
Lead pre-silicon verification for next-gen firewall ASICs in Santa Clara. Define methodologies, architect test benches, and ensure coverage using SystemVerilog/UVM. Requires 5+ years' experience taking ASICs from concept to production. Expertise in simulation, emulation, and formal verification i...
Location Icon
Location
United States , Santa Clara
Salary Icon
Salary
173600.00 - 280700.00 USD / Year
paloaltonetworks.com Logo
Palo Alto Networks
Expiration Date
Until further notice
Principal Software Engineer
Save Icon
Lead the design of scalable infrastructure for next-gen security solutions at Palo Alto Networks. This Santa Clara-based role requires deep expertise in Red Hat OpenShift, AI/ML hardware, and automation with Ansible/Pulumi. Ensure 99.99% uptime by architecting resilient systems and automating dep...
Location Icon
Location
United States , Santa Clara
Salary Icon
Salary
147000.00 - 237500.00 USD / Year
paloaltonetworks.com Logo
Palo Alto Networks
Expiration Date
Until further notice
Principal AI Test Engineer - Prisma Access
Save Icon
Lead AI-driven quality transformation for Prisma Access as a Principal Test Engineer. Design autonomous QA workflows using AI/ML and LLMs to achieve unprecedented test coverage in cybersecurity. This Santa Clara-based role requires 10+ years in test automation and expertise in Python/Go, cloud ne...
Location Icon
Location
United States , Santa Clara
Salary Icon
Salary
147000.00 - 237500.00 USD / Year
paloaltonetworks.com Logo
Palo Alto Networks
Expiration Date
Until further notice
Principal Software Engineer (Browser Extension)
Save Icon
Lead the development of innovative browser extensions and client-side software for Palo Alto Networks' ADEM platform. This Santa Clara-based role requires expert JavaScript/TypeScript skills and experience with AI-powered dev tools. You'll design scalable systems, leveraging your deep knowledge o...
Location Icon
Location
United States , Santa Clara
Salary Icon
Salary
147000.00 - 237500.00 USD / Year
paloaltonetworks.com Logo
Palo Alto Networks
Expiration Date
Until further notice
Principal Software Engineer (Prisma Access Browser)
Save Icon
Lead the architecture of a secure, Chromium-based enterprise browser in Tel Aviv. As a Principal Software Engineer, leverage your 8+ years of C++ mastery to solve complex performance and multi-threaded challenges. Drive innovation, mentor a talented team, and set new standards in browser security...
Location Icon
Location
Israel , Tel Aviv
Salary Icon
Salary
Not provided
paloaltonetworks.com Logo
Palo Alto Networks
Expiration Date
Until further notice
Principal Kernel / Linux Virtualization Engineer
Save Icon
Join AMD's team in Munich as a Principal Kernel/Virtualization Engineer. Drive the design of core CPU and SoC features for the Linux kernel, focusing on x86 architecture, security, and virtualization. This senior role requires 12+ years of expertise in full-cycle development and open-source contr...
Location Icon
Location
Germany , Munich
Salary Icon
Salary
Not provided
amd.com Logo
AMD
Expiration Date
Until further notice
Principal Software Development Engineer
Save Icon
Join our core team in Warsaw as a Principal Software Development Engineer. You will research, prototype, and optimize ML algorithms for GPU deployment, focusing on graphics and quantization. We seek an expert in Python/PyTorch, C/C++, and ML pipelines, passionate about cutting-edge hardware. Coll...
Location Icon
Location
Poland , Warsaw
Salary Icon
Salary
Not provided
amd.com Logo
AMD
Expiration Date
Until further notice
Principal Software Engineer
Save Icon
Join our AI Infrastructure team in Shanghai as a Principal GPU Software Engineer. Architect and optimize the core inference engine for large-scale Generative AI models. We require deep expertise in CUDA/C++ kernel development, NVIDIA architectures, and performance profiling. Design custom operato...
Location Icon
Location
China , Shanghai
Salary Icon
Salary
Not provided
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Principal Data Engineer
Save Icon
Lead the design of modern data platforms as a Principal Data Engineer at NTT DATA in Bangalore. Utilize your deep expertise in Azure Data Factory, SQL, and big data tools to build scalable ETL processes and data models. This hybrid role requires strong analytical skills and offers a chance to tra...
Location Icon
Location
India , Bangalore
Salary Icon
Salary
Not provided
nttdata.com Logo
NTT DATA
Expiration Date
Until further notice
Principal Software Engineer- Full Stack
Save Icon
Lead technical architecture for Microsoft's Power Pages as a Principal Full Stack Engineer in Bangalore. Drive the development of secure, high-scale external websites using C++, C#, or Java. Mentor teams and shape product vision while leveraging Azure and Power Platform integration.
Location Icon
Location
India , Bangalore
Salary Icon
Salary
Not provided
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Principal Research Engineer - Generative AI - AI Frontiers
Save Icon
Join Microsoft Research's AI Frontiers lab in Redmond as a Principal Research Engineer. Tackle ambitious challenges in Generative AI, reinforcement learning, and LLM development (pre/mid/post-training). Utilize your expertise in Python, PyTorch/JAX, and large-scale model optimization to drive cut...
Location Icon
Location
United States , Redmond
Salary Icon
Salary
139900.00 - 274800.00 USD / Year
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ice
Principal Software Engineer
Save Icon
Lead the development of Microsoft's critical security cloud platform as a Principal Software Engineer in Dublin. This role requires a Bachelor's in Computer Science, 6+ years of coding experience (C#, Java, Python, etc.), and strong technical leadership. You will design large-scale distributed se...
Location Icon
Location
Ireland , Dublin
Salary Icon
Salary
Not provided
https://www.microsoft.com/ Logo
Microsoft Corporation
Expiration Date
Until further notice

About the Principal Engineer role

Explore the pinnacle of technical leadership with Principal Engineer jobs. A Principal Engineer is a master-level technical expert and strategic leader within an engineering organization. This is not merely a senior role; it represents the apex of an individual contributor technical track, where influence, architectural vision, and deep expertise converge to shape the technological future of a company. Professionals in these roles are the go-to authorities for the most complex, high-impact challenges, setting technical standards and driving innovation across multiple teams or the entire organization.

The common responsibilities of a Principal Engineer are vast and critical to long-term success. Typically, they involve defining and driving the long-term technical strategy and architectural vision for major platforms or product suites. They are responsible for researching, prototyping, and selecting technologies that will scale to meet future business needs. A core part of their duties includes leading the design and implementation of complex, cross-functional systems, ensuring they are resilient, secure, and efficient. They serve as the ultimate escalation point for critical production issues, conducting deep-dive analysis and root cause investigations to resolve systemic problems. Furthermore, Principal Engineers have a significant mentorship and governance function, actively coaching senior and staff engineers, establishing best practices, and conducting rigorous code and design reviews to maintain exceptional quality across all engineering outputs. They are also key collaborators, working closely with engineering managers, product leaders, and enterprise architects to align technical execution with business objectives.

The typical skills and requirements for these high-level positions are extensive. A bachelor's or master's degree in computer science, engineering, or a related field is common, though equivalent demonstrable experience is often acceptable. Most roles require a minimum of 10+ years of progressive, hands-on software development or infrastructure engineering experience, with a significant portion spent in lead or architecture-focused positions. Essential technical skills include mastery of relevant programming languages and frameworks, profound knowledge of system design patterns and distributed architectures, and expertise in cloud platforms like AWS, Azure, or GCP. They must possess exceptional analytical and problem-solving abilities to deconstruct ambiguous, complex problems. Beyond technical prowess, superior soft skills are non-negotiable; this includes outstanding communication to articulate technical vision to both technical and non-technical stakeholders, proven leadership and influence without formal authority, and strategic business acumen. For those seeking to define technological frontiers and mentor the next generation of experts, Principal Engineer jobs offer a challenging and highly rewarding career path at the forefront of innovation.